From 986aa62ed00bee39363bab41b4eeb8259d446efd Mon Sep 17 00:00:00 2001 From: ludc <ludc@vci-tech.com> Date: 星期四, 16 一月 2025 18:20:32 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/master' --- Source/plt-web/plt-web-ui/src/page/index/logo.vue | 30 ++++++++++++++---------------- 1 files changed, 14 insertions(+), 16 deletions(-) diff --git a/Source/plt-web/plt-web-ui/src/page/index/logo.vue b/Source/plt-web/plt-web-ui/src/page/index/logo.vue index a89e19e..b2a514c 100644 --- a/Source/plt-web/plt-web-ui/src/page/index/logo.vue +++ b/Source/plt-web/plt-web-ui/src/page/index/logo.vue @@ -1,24 +1,21 @@ <template> <div class="avue-logo"> <transition name="fade"> - <span v-if="keyCollapse" - class="avue-logo_subtitle" - key="0"> + <span v-if="isCollapse" class="avue-logo_subtitle" key="0"> <img class="imgTop" :src=imgurl> </span> </transition> <transition-group name="fade"> - <template v-if="!keyCollapse"> -<span> - <img class="imgSpan" :src=imgurl> - </span> - <span class="avue-logo_title" - key="1"> + <template v-if="!isCollapse"> + <span> + <img class="imgSpan" :src=imgurl> + </span> + <span class="avue-logo_title" key="1"> <span> <img class="imgSpan" :src=imgurl> </span> <span class="indexTitle"> {{ website.indexTitle }}</span> - </span> + </span> </template> </transition-group> </div> @@ -38,26 +35,25 @@ created() { }, computed: { - ...mapGetters(["website", "keyCollapse"]) + ...mapGetters(["website", "isCollapse"]) }, methods: {} }; </script> -<style lang="scss"> +<style lang="scss" scoped> .fade-leave-active { - transition: opacity 0.2s; + transition: opacity 0.3s; } .fade-enter-active { - transition: opacity 2.5s; + transition: opacity .3s; } .fade-enter, .fade-leave-to { opacity: 0; } - .avue-logo { position: fixed; top: 0; @@ -72,6 +68,8 @@ box-shadow: 0 1px 2px 0 rgba(0, 0, 0, 0.15); color: rgba(255, 255, 255, 0.8); z-index: 1024; + -webkit-transition: width .2s; + transition: width .2s; &_title { display: block; @@ -101,7 +99,7 @@ } .indexTitle{ //background-image: linear-gradient(120deg, #54b6d0 16%, #3f8bdb, #3f8bdb); - background-image: linear-gradient(-225deg, #5D9FFF 0%, #B8DCFF 48%, #6BBBFF 100%); + background-image: linear-gradient(-225deg, #5D9FFF 0%, #9cbcdc 48%, #6BBBFF 100%); background-clip: text; color: transparent; font-weight: 700; -- Gitblit v1.9.3